
This week, the Minnesota Department of Employment and Economic Development (DEED) awarded some $2.8 million from the Minnesota Forward Fund (MFF) to establish a one-of-a-kind academic-industry technology center at the University of Minnesota, Twin Cities campus.
The University of Minnesota (UMN) Twin Cities campus, in collaboration with Polar Semiconductor and Honeywell Aerospace, is building a one-of-a-kind academic-industry technology center to support and advance the state's growing microelectronics and semiconductor industry.
The new center will develop quantum spintronic devices focusing on high-tech magnetic sensors and advanced memory storage. The emerging magnetic-based technologies are being adapted for various cutting-edge applications, including biomedical devices, industrial automation, automotive applications, and memory and computing for specialized devices, like those designed for extreme environments like outer space.
The total program cost is $5.7 million. Polar and Honeywell Aerospace will each provide $1.4 million in matching funds for student research, professional development and in-kind cash, as well as equipment usage, process and integration engineer labor and time and assistance designing courses used for training.
Over the next ten years, the center will also provide specialized coursework and hands-on research opportunities for more than 300 people, including undergraduate through Ph.D. students from the University's electrical and computer engineering, materials science, and physics programs, as well as students from local community colleges and other universities.
The center will also offer specialized training in the use and manufacture of spintronic devices for engineers and technicians for Polar Semiconductor, Honeywell Aerospace and other Minnesota microelectronic companies.
